Study Summary
This observational study assessed whether measurements of certain pro-inflammatory and anti-inflammatory cytokines in the blood (either singly or in combination) at birth and/or up to day of life 21 can predict cerebral palsy at 18-22 months corrected age.

Trial Details
| Field | Value |
|---|---|
| Enrollment Target | 1,067 participants |
| Start Date | 1999-07 |
| Est. Completion | 2004-05 |
